body {

      font: 1em/140% Candara, 'Trebuchet MS', Verdana, Arial, Helvetica, sans-serif;

      background: #4a525a url(bg_aplatz_streif_4a525a_577x512.png) no-repeat right bottom fixed;

      color: #c0c6cc;

    }



a {   color: #c0c6cc;

      border-bottom: 1px solid #626a73;

    }



var { background-color: #4a525a;

			border-top: 1px solid #626a73;

	  }



#logo { color: #626a73 }

#logo dt a { color: #626a73; border: none }



#nav_tree dl { color: #fff }

#nav_tree a { background: inherit }



#nav_tree a:hover,

#nav_tags a:hover,

#topic a:hover,

#footer a:hover,

#facebox a:hover,

a.hilite {

      background-color: #626a73;

      color: #fff;

}



abbr,

#nav_tags,

#topic h1,

#comments,

.meta_i,

.details_i { border-color: #626a73 }





dt, dt a { color: #fff }

#comment_form dt { color: #c0c6cc }



#topic { background: transparent }



#topic h1, #topic h2, #topic h2 a, #topic h3, #topic h4,

#facebox h3, #facebox h4, #facebox em, #facebox blockquote {

      background: transparent;

      color: #fff;

    }



/* .compact dl.narrow dd a.hilite { background: #626a73 } */



.details_i dl dd span { color: #7A8189 }



.facebox_overlayBG,

#floatr_overlay { background-color: #25292d }

#facebox { color: #c0c6cc }

#facebox h4 { color: #fff }

#facebox a { color: #c0c6cc }

#facebox .slide_m, #facebox .contact_form { border-color: #626a73 }



div.errors {

      font-weight: bold;

      color: #f30;

    }

div.confirm {

      font-weight: bold;

      color: #0f3;

    }

dd input, dd textarea {

      color: #c0c6cc;

      background-color: #4A525A;

      border-color: #626a73;

    }

input#submit { font: 1em/140% Candara, Verdana, Arial, Helvetica, sans-serif }
